The Dallas – Ft. Worth Dachshund Club, Inc was founded to further the advancement and development of purebred Dachshunds and to give persons engaged in breeding and exhibiting Dachshunds an opportunity to exchange ideas. We hope you find our site informative and useful.

Luna’s Story

Cute little Luna was a 1-year-old black and tan smooth miniature

female dachshund when her concerned owner called us for help.

She had an older Labrador retriever that was consistently

trying to injure Luna. Luna weighed only 6 ½ pounds so this

was a serious concern. The owner had worked hard to divide the

house in half so each dog could have part of the house, but this

was proving unsustainable, in the long term, for her and her

family. At that point, we agreed to accept Luna into our rescue

program.

Thankfully, Luna had been generally well cared for and only

needed routine vet care including vaccines, spay surgery and a

microchip. Former adopters were ready for a young dachshund

and, when they met Luna, they quickly fell in love. We were not

surprised! Luna has settled in beautifully and made friends with

their older dachshund (also adopted from us). Her new family

reports she has the perfect blend of energy—happy to run and

play but also willing to cuddle up with them on the couch. Live

long and prosper Luna!

DACHSHUND FACTS

In Germany, the Dachshund is also called the Teckel.

A Miniature Dachshund typically weighs 11 pounds or less as an adult.

The Wirehaired Dachshund is covered with a coarse, wiry coat like those of most terrier breeds and is distinguished by their well defined eyebrows and beards.

Despite their small size, Dachshunds are extremely courageous.

There are 3 types of coat varieties in the Dachshund - Smooth, Longhair and Wirehair.

A "piebald" Dachshund has patterns like a Beagle or Basset Hound with large regular patches of white.

Dachshunds love to be with people. If you want to be followed everywhere you go, then the Dachshund is the dog for you!

Black & Tan Dachshunds have tan markings on their head, chest, and paws.
